Lets compare vitamin content per 100 grams of Fresh Orange juice vs Boiled Eggplant with Salt:
- 100 grams of Fresh Orange juice have 1.5 times more Vitamin B2, 2.5 times more Vitamin B5, 2.1 times more Vitamin B9 and 38.5 times more Vitamin C than Boiled Eggplant with Salt.
- While 100 g of Boiled and Drained Eggplant with Salt contain 1.5 times more Vitamin B3, 2.2 times more Vitamin B6, 10.3 times more Vitamin E and 29 times more Vitamin K than Raw Orange juice.
- Both Fresh Orange juice and Boiled Eggplant with Salt provide similar amounts of Vitamin B1 per 100 grams.
- 100 grams of Fresh Orange juice have insufficient amounts of Vitamin E and Vitamin K
- 100 grams of Boiled Eggplant with Sal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B2, Vitamin B5 and Vitamin C
- Both Raw Orange juice as well as Boiled and Drained Eggplant with Sal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in 100 grams.
Comparing minerals per 100 grams for Fresh Orange juice vs Boiled Eggplant with Salt:
- 100 grams of Fresh Orange juice have 1.6 times more Potassium than Boiled Eggplant with Salt.
- While 100 g of Boiled and Drained Eggplant with Salt contain 1.3 times more Copper, 8.1 times more Manganese and 239 times more Sodium than Raw Orange juice.
- Both Fresh Orange juice and Boiled Eggplant with Salt contain similar levels of Iron, Magnesium, Phosphorus and Water per 100 grams.
- 100 grams of Fresh Orange juice lack sufficient amounts of Manganese
- Both Raw Orange juice as well as Boiled and Drained Eggplant with Salt lack sufficient amounts of Calcium, Selenium and Zinc in 100 grams.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 100 grams:
- 100 grams of Fresh Orange juice have 1.3 times more Carbohydrate and 2.6 times more Sugars than Boiled Eggplant with Salt.
- While 100 g of Boiled and Drained Eggplant with Salt contain 12.5 times more Fiber than Raw Orange juice.
- 100 grams of Fresh Orange juice provide inadequate amounts of Fiber
- Both Raw Orange juice as well as Boiled and Drained Eggplant with Salt provide inadequate amounts of Energy, Omega 3, Omega 6 and Protein in 100 grams.
